In an interview on ‘The Julia Show’, Kygo stated that there is a new album in the works.
The new mystery album will be the first full-length album since his 2020 release ‘Golden Hour’. The 18-track release was packed with dance floor anthems such as ‘Freedom’ featuring Zak Abel, ‘Higher Love’, ‘Lose Somebody’, and ‘Like It Is’. Despite these songs still being played widely to date, this past year alone he’s released three explosive singles including ‘Freeze’ and ‘Never Really Loved Me’, and ‘Lost Without You’ featuring Dean Lewis.
During the interview, Kygo let the world know that he wasn’t holding back from showcasing some of the music he’s been working on. “I’m working on a lot of music,” Kygo said. “I was just in L.A. this whole week in the studio. Hopefully, I will have an album ready soon.”
Recently, Kygo headlined at Lollapalooza in Chicago, Illinois at Grant Park and made it a night worthwhile. He brought out Chance The Rapper for ‘No Problem’ and a few other favorite Chance The Rapper tracks. In a fun addition, Kygo also brought out Benny The Bull, the mascot for the NBA’s Chicago Bulls.
